Embodiment Construction

[0034] The present invention will be described in detail below according to the accompanying drawings, which is a preferred embodiment in various embodiments of the present invention. The technical idea of ​​the present invention is not limited or limited thereto, and can be variously deformed and implemented by those skilled in the art .

[0035] The technical problem to be solved in this embodiment is to realize lane keeping of vehicles on the basis of lane line detection.

[0036] Specifically, such as figure 1 As shown, the solution of the embodiment of the present invention mainly includes: lane line detection; converting the lane line in the two-dimensional image to the vehicle body coordinates to obtain the real lane line; combining the information of the real lane line to obtain the position information of the virtual lane line ; Combining real lane line position information and virtual lane line position information to calculate the angle and degree of deviation of t...

Abstract

The invention provides a lane-keeping control method for a vehicle. The lane-keeping control method for the vehicle comprises the steps of first, using an image captured by a vehicle-mounted camera todetect a lane line and then converting the detected lane line from an image coordinate system into a vehicle body coordinate system. According to the lane-keeping control method for the vehicle, twoconcepts of a virtual lane line and a real lane line are presented; and the deviation angle and deviation degree of the vehicle relative to the lane are calculated according to position information ofthe real lane line and position information of the virtual lane line. Finally, steering control amount is calculated according to the deviation amount to realize lane keeping.
